Jake is making bracelets to give to his sisters. He uses 4 rainbow charms and 8 white star charms for his younger sister's brace

let. He makes his older sister's bracelet a little bigger, so he uses 5 rainbow charms and 10 white star charms. Does Jake use the same ratio of rainbow charms to white star charms in both bracelets?

Answer: Yes.

Step-by-step explanation: 4:8 simplifies to 1:2, since he used half as many rainbow charms as he did white stars. 5:10 also simplifies to 1:2. If they both have half as many rainbow charms as white, then both of his sister’s bracelets keep the same ratio.

An angle measures 94" more than the measure of its supplementary angle. What is the
PIT_PIT [208]

Answer:

The measure of the angles are 137 and 43

Step-by-step explanation:

Firstly, we need to understand what is meant by saying two angles are supplementary.Two angles are termed supplementary if the addition of the value of both angles equal 180.

Now let the two angles we are seeking in this question be x and y respectively

We write our first equation using the supplementary information;

x + y = 180 •••••••••••(i)

Secondly we are made to know that the difference between these angles is 94

Mathematically;

x - y = 94

or simply x = 94 + y; insert this into equation 1 above

94 + y + y = 180

2y = 180 - 94

2y = 86

y = 86/2

y = 43

x = 94 + y = 94 + 43 = 137
